"Agamemnon", Aeschylus

Dear gods, set me free from all the pain,
from the watch I keep, one whole year awake...
propped on my arms, crouched on the roofs of Atreus
like a dog.
		I know the stars by heart,
the companies of the night, and there in the lead
the ones that bring us snow or the warm summer,
bring us all we have --
our great kings blazing across the sky,
I know them, when they sink and when they rise...
and now I watch for the light, the signal-fire
breaking out of Troy, shouting Troy is taken.
So she commands, full of her high hopes.
That woman -- she maneuvers like a man.

And when I keep to my bed, soaked in dew,
and the thoughts go drifting through the night
and sleep's aide, good dreams...not here,
it's the old comrade, terror at my neck.
I mustn't sleep, no --
			Look alive, sentry.
And I try to pick out tunes, I hum a little,
a good cure for sleep, and the tears start,
I sob for all that's come to the house.
So badly managed now.
Men die and things go down.

Oh for a blessed end to all our pain,
some godsend burning through the dark....

Psalm 61

Hear my cry, O G-D; attend unto my prayer.
From the end of the earth will I cry unto thee, when my heart is
    overwhelmed: lead me to the rock that is higher than I.
For thou hast been a shelter for me, and a strong tower from the
    enemy.
I will abide in thy tabernacle for ever: I will trust in the covert
    of thy wings.  Selah.
For thou, O G-D, hast heard my vows: thou hast given me the heritage
    of those that fear thy name.
Thou wilt prolong the king's life:  and his years as many generations.
He shall abide before G-D for ever:  O prepare mercy and truth, which
    may preserve him.
So will I sing praise unto thy name for ever, that I may daily
    perform my vows.
